    Taschenbuch. Condición: Neu. Neuware - The ground always tells you. Sometimes you wish it wouldn't.Earl 'Digger' Boggs knows how to read soil. He can tell a period burial from a fresh one, a relic scatter from a disturbed site. When he and his wife Rayleen join a preservation survey near Shiloh, he expects Confederate camp relics and a rare week off that doesn't involve driving twelve hours to ask a stranger for permission.He doesn't expect a modern body in a hidden hollow.The discovery pulls them into a decade-old disappearance, a fresh killing, and a knot of lies tangled around land rights, survey data, and what someone is still desperate to keep buried. The deeper Earl reads the ground, the clearer it becomes - the battlefield isn't the only thing hiding its dead.To uncover the truth, Earl must trust the evidence in the soil, the instincts of the woman beside him, and one rule every detectorist learns sooner or later: the ground always tells you.Shallow Graves at Shiloh is Book 5 in the Dirt & Disorder Mysteries - a cozy mystery series set against the Civil War battlefields of the American South, featuring retired mail carrier and lifelong relic hunter Earl Boggs.

    Taschenbuch. Condición: Neu. Neuware - Most detectorists hunt by feel. Earl Boggs hunts by research.When a Franklin relic dealer offers him first look at a private sale inventory - forty-one pieces, authenticated provenance, serious money - Earl reads it the way he reads everything. Carefully. And what he finds in the equipment signatures shouldn't be there.Assault infantry material attributed to ground the Confederate assault never reached. Someone pulled those pieces from the battlefield corridor. Someone falsified the record. And an authenticator who asked the same question Earl is asking is already dead.Earl has a sanctioned hunt to finish and a phone call to make. He plans to do both in the right order.

    Taschenbuch. Condición: Neu. Neuware - Veteran detector Earl Boggs knows better than to cross a fence line onto federal land. But when he spots signs of fresh digging, just inside the boundary of Kennesaw Mountain National Battlefield Park, he takes note-and walks away.Two days later, a Cobb County detective and a National Park Service ranger are at his door. Someone has been stealing Civil War artifacts from protected ground, moving them through collector circles, and turning buried history into profit. Earl's trained eye may be the one thing that can connect the disturbed earth, the forged provenance, and the people who know exactly what lies hidden at Kennesaw.To uncover the truth, Earl must follow the evidence through research rooms, artifact networks, and old relationships that refuse to stay buried. But every answer pulls him closer to a scheme built on greed, deception, and a dangerous knowledge of the past.Cold Iron at Kennesaw is the third book in the Dirt & Disorder Mysteries series.

    Taschenbuch. Condición: Neu. Neuware - Some detectives look for clues. Earl Boggs digs for them.Earl Boggs has been reading the ground for thirty-four years. He knows what a good signal sounds like, how to research a site before he ever swings a coil, and exactly where to look on an eleven-acre field outside Ringgold, Georgia that nobody has touched since 1863.What he doesn't expect to find is a sealed burner phone buried four inches down next to a Confederate artillery shell.When the landowner turns up dead the next morning, Earl realizes that whatever Wayne Tatum was protecting in that field was worth killing for - and that the only person who can figure out what it is happens to be standing in a hole he dug himself.With his wife Rayleen, his detecting partner Burl, and a librarian who keeps better records than the county itself, Earl works the case the same way he works a site: slow, methodical, and by knowing things nobody else thought to look for.Dead Signal at Chickamauga is the first book in the Dirt & Disorder Mysteries series - where the clues are buried, the history is real, and the detective has a Minelab.

    Paperback. Condición: new. Paperback. Earl Boggs knows battlefield ground does not give up its secrets easily. When a fellow detectorist sends him to a cattle farm bordering the Resaca battlefield, Earl expects artillery fragments and trespass trouble - not a trail that leads into old Civil War ground, a landowner's son who turns up dead, and signs that someone else has been hunting the same property in the dark.As Earl follows military records, land deeds, and faint signals through the Georgia clay, the mystery widens from illegal relic hunting to murder. Somewhere along the Confederate retreat route, something was buried in haste and protected in silence for more than a century. Now Earl has to find it before the next person ends up in the ground.No Rest at Resaca is the second Dirt & Disorder Mysteries novel - a story of history, hidden evidence, and the men and women determined to uncover what the past tried to keep. From the Shenandoah Valley to Sherman's March to the Sea, Civil War armies marched, camped, fought, and left behind thousands of artifacts that still lie in the ground today. This book shows you how to find them-legally, ethically, and with purpose. Hunt Where History Happened gives you the research methods, historical context, and field strategies to identify high-potential Civil War sites, secure landowner permission, and recover artifacts that contribute to the historical record. Inside you'll learn: What Civil War armies left behind-and whereHow to research campaign corridors using primary sourcesHow to identify camps, skirmish sites, crossings, and battlefieldsA step-by-step site research pipeline that actually worksHow to find and secure private landowner permissionLegal, ethical, and preservation best practices10 major Civil War campaign corridors with research strategies and detecting opportunitiesHow to document and preserve artifacts so they contribute to history Whether you're a detectorist, historian, genealogist, or Civil War enthusiast, this book will help you walk the ground with understanding-and turn what you find into knowledge that lasts. Hunt Where History Happened is Book 4 in the Metal Detecting Mastery Series by Brian Dulaney, author of the Dirt & Disorder Mysteries. This item is printed on demand.
